Loading…

Content-Adaptive Feature-Based CU Size Prediction for Fast Low-Delay Video Encoding in HEVC

Determining the best partitioning structure of a coding tree unit is one of the most time-consuming operations in High Efficiency Video Coding (HEVC) encoding. Specifically, it is the evaluation of the quadtree hierarchy using the rate-distortion (RD) optimization that has the most significant impac...

Full description

Saved in:
Bibliographic Details
Published in:IEEE transactions on circuits and systems for video technology 2018-03, Vol.28 (3), p.693-705
Main Authors: Mallikarachchi, Thanuja, Talagala, Dumidu S., Arachchi, Hemantha Kodikara, Fernando, Anil
Format: Article
Language:English
Subjects:
Citations: Items that this one cites
Items that cite this one
Online Access:Get full text
Tags: Add Tag
No Tags, Be the first to tag this record!
cited_by cdi_FETCH-LOGICAL-c339t-d0cf99cb64a00b640efb788ede214743b94dfaa5eab62c389d8cd8c3dac73c653
cites cdi_FETCH-LOGICAL-c339t-d0cf99cb64a00b640efb788ede214743b94dfaa5eab62c389d8cd8c3dac73c653
container_end_page 705
container_issue 3
container_start_page 693
container_title IEEE transactions on circuits and systems for video technology
container_volume 28
creator Mallikarachchi, Thanuja
Talagala, Dumidu S.
Arachchi, Hemantha Kodikara
Fernando, Anil
description Determining the best partitioning structure of a coding tree unit is one of the most time-consuming operations in High Efficiency Video Coding (HEVC) encoding. Specifically, it is the evaluation of the quadtree hierarchy using the rate-distortion (RD) optimization that has the most significant impact on the encoding time, especially in the cases of high definition (HD) and ultra HD videos. In order to expedite the encoding for low-delay applications, this paper proposes a coding unit (CU) size selection and encoding algorithm for inter prediction in the HEVC. To this end, it describes: 1) two CU classification models based on Inter N\times N mode motion features and RD cost thresholds to predict the CU split decision; 2) an online training scheme for dynamic content adaptation; 3) a motion vector reuse mechanism to expedite the motion estimation process; and 4) finally introduces a computational complexity to coding efficiency tradeoff process to enable flexible control of the algorithm. The experimental results reveal that the proposed algorithm achieves a consistent average encoding time performance ranging from 55%-58% and 57%-61% with average Bjøntegaard delta bit rate increases of 1.93%-2.26% and 2.14%-2.33% compared with the HEVC 16.0 reference software for the low delay P and low delay B configurations, respectively, across a wide range of content types and bit rates.
doi_str_mv 10.1109/TCSVT.2016.2619499
format article
fullrecord <record><control><sourceid>proquest_cross</sourceid><recordid>TN_cdi_proquest_journals_2174532169</recordid><sourceformat>XML</sourceformat><sourcesystem>PC</sourcesystem><ieee_id>7600428</ieee_id><sourcerecordid>2174532169</sourcerecordid><originalsourceid>FETCH-LOGICAL-c339t-d0cf99cb64a00b640efb788ede214743b94dfaa5eab62c389d8cd8c3dac73c653</originalsourceid><addsrcrecordid>eNo9kE1LAzEQhhdRsFb_gF4Cnrfmc3dzrGtrhYJCPy4eQprMSkrd1CRV6q93tUUYZubwPjPwZNk1wQNCsLyb17PlfEAxKQa0IJJLeZL1iBBVTikWp92OBckrSsR5dhHjGmPCK172stfatwnalA-t3ib3CWgMOu0C5Pc6gkX1As3cN6CXANaZ5HyLGh_QWMeEpv4rf4CN3qOls-DRqDXeuvYNuRZNRsv6Mjtr9CbC1XH2s8V4NK8n-fT58akeTnPDmEy5xaaR0qwKrjHuOoZmVVYVWKCEl5ytJLeN1gL0qqCGVdJWpitmtSmZKQTrZ7eHu9vgP3YQk1r7XWi7l4qSkgtGSSG7FD2kTPAxBmjUNrh3HfaKYPUrUf1JVL8S1VFiB90cIAcA_0BZYMxpxX4AZp1tgQ</addsrcrecordid><sourcetype>Aggregation Database</sourcetype><iscdi>true</iscdi><recordtype>article</recordtype><pqid>2174532169</pqid></control><display><type>article</type><title>Content-Adaptive Feature-Based CU Size Prediction for Fast Low-Delay Video Encoding in HEVC</title><source>IEEE Xplore (Online service)</source><creator>Mallikarachchi, Thanuja ; Talagala, Dumidu S. ; Arachchi, Hemantha Kodikara ; Fernando, Anil</creator><creatorcontrib>Mallikarachchi, Thanuja ; Talagala, Dumidu S. ; Arachchi, Hemantha Kodikara ; Fernando, Anil</creatorcontrib><description>Determining the best partitioning structure of a coding tree unit is one of the most time-consuming operations in High Efficiency Video Coding (HEVC) encoding. Specifically, it is the evaluation of the quadtree hierarchy using the rate-distortion (RD) optimization that has the most significant impact on the encoding time, especially in the cases of high definition (HD) and ultra HD videos. In order to expedite the encoding for low-delay applications, this paper proposes a coding unit (CU) size selection and encoding algorithm for inter prediction in the HEVC. To this end, it describes: 1) two CU classification models based on Inter &lt;inline-formula&gt; &lt;tex-math notation="LaTeX"&gt;N\times N &lt;/tex-math&gt;&lt;/inline-formula&gt; mode motion features and RD cost thresholds to predict the CU split decision; 2) an online training scheme for dynamic content adaptation; 3) a motion vector reuse mechanism to expedite the motion estimation process; and 4) finally introduces a computational complexity to coding efficiency tradeoff process to enable flexible control of the algorithm. The experimental results reveal that the proposed algorithm achieves a consistent average encoding time performance ranging from 55%-58% and 57%-61% with average Bjøntegaard delta bit rate increases of 1.93%-2.26% and 2.14%-2.33% compared with the HEVC 16.0 reference software for the low delay P and low delay B configurations, respectively, across a wide range of content types and bit rates.</description><identifier>ISSN: 1051-8215</identifier><identifier>EISSN: 1558-2205</identifier><identifier>DOI: 10.1109/TCSVT.2016.2619499</identifier><identifier>CODEN: ITCTEM</identifier><language>eng</language><publisher>New York: IEEE</publisher><subject>Adaptation models ; Algorithms ; Coding ; Coding unit (CU) size ; Computational complexity ; Computer architecture ; Delay ; Encoding ; High definition ; High Efficiency Video Coding (HEVC) ; low delay ; motion classification ; Motion simulation ; Optimization ; Prediction algorithms ; ratedistortion (RD) optimization ; video coding ; Video compression</subject><ispartof>IEEE transactions on circuits and systems for video technology, 2018-03, Vol.28 (3), p.693-705</ispartof><rights>Copyright The Institute of Electrical and Electronics Engineers, Inc. (IEEE) 2018</rights><lds50>peer_reviewed</lds50><oa>free_for_read</oa><woscitedreferencessubscribed>false</woscitedreferencessubscribed><citedby>FETCH-LOGICAL-c339t-d0cf99cb64a00b640efb788ede214743b94dfaa5eab62c389d8cd8c3dac73c653</citedby><cites>FETCH-LOGICAL-c339t-d0cf99cb64a00b640efb788ede214743b94dfaa5eab62c389d8cd8c3dac73c653</cites><orcidid>0000-0001-9817-927X</orcidid></display><links><openurl>$$Topenurl_article</openurl><openurlfulltext>$$Topenurlfull_article</openurlfulltext><thumbnail>$$Tsyndetics_thumb_exl</thumbnail><linktohtml>$$Uhttps://ieeexplore.ieee.org/document/7600428$$EHTML$$P50$$Gieee$$H</linktohtml><link.rule.ids>314,780,784,27924,27925,54796</link.rule.ids></links><search><creatorcontrib>Mallikarachchi, Thanuja</creatorcontrib><creatorcontrib>Talagala, Dumidu S.</creatorcontrib><creatorcontrib>Arachchi, Hemantha Kodikara</creatorcontrib><creatorcontrib>Fernando, Anil</creatorcontrib><title>Content-Adaptive Feature-Based CU Size Prediction for Fast Low-Delay Video Encoding in HEVC</title><title>IEEE transactions on circuits and systems for video technology</title><addtitle>TCSVT</addtitle><description>Determining the best partitioning structure of a coding tree unit is one of the most time-consuming operations in High Efficiency Video Coding (HEVC) encoding. Specifically, it is the evaluation of the quadtree hierarchy using the rate-distortion (RD) optimization that has the most significant impact on the encoding time, especially in the cases of high definition (HD) and ultra HD videos. In order to expedite the encoding for low-delay applications, this paper proposes a coding unit (CU) size selection and encoding algorithm for inter prediction in the HEVC. To this end, it describes: 1) two CU classification models based on Inter &lt;inline-formula&gt; &lt;tex-math notation="LaTeX"&gt;N\times N &lt;/tex-math&gt;&lt;/inline-formula&gt; mode motion features and RD cost thresholds to predict the CU split decision; 2) an online training scheme for dynamic content adaptation; 3) a motion vector reuse mechanism to expedite the motion estimation process; and 4) finally introduces a computational complexity to coding efficiency tradeoff process to enable flexible control of the algorithm. The experimental results reveal that the proposed algorithm achieves a consistent average encoding time performance ranging from 55%-58% and 57%-61% with average Bjøntegaard delta bit rate increases of 1.93%-2.26% and 2.14%-2.33% compared with the HEVC 16.0 reference software for the low delay P and low delay B configurations, respectively, across a wide range of content types and bit rates.</description><subject>Adaptation models</subject><subject>Algorithms</subject><subject>Coding</subject><subject>Coding unit (CU) size</subject><subject>Computational complexity</subject><subject>Computer architecture</subject><subject>Delay</subject><subject>Encoding</subject><subject>High definition</subject><subject>High Efficiency Video Coding (HEVC)</subject><subject>low delay</subject><subject>motion classification</subject><subject>Motion simulation</subject><subject>Optimization</subject><subject>Prediction algorithms</subject><subject>ratedistortion (RD) optimization</subject><subject>video coding</subject><subject>Video compression</subject><issn>1051-8215</issn><issn>1558-2205</issn><fulltext>true</fulltext><rsrctype>article</rsrctype><creationdate>2018</creationdate><recordtype>article</recordtype><recordid>eNo9kE1LAzEQhhdRsFb_gF4Cnrfmc3dzrGtrhYJCPy4eQprMSkrd1CRV6q93tUUYZubwPjPwZNk1wQNCsLyb17PlfEAxKQa0IJJLeZL1iBBVTikWp92OBckrSsR5dhHjGmPCK172stfatwnalA-t3ib3CWgMOu0C5Pc6gkX1As3cN6CXANaZ5HyLGh_QWMeEpv4rf4CN3qOls-DRqDXeuvYNuRZNRsv6Mjtr9CbC1XH2s8V4NK8n-fT58akeTnPDmEy5xaaR0qwKrjHuOoZmVVYVWKCEl5ytJLeN1gL0qqCGVdJWpitmtSmZKQTrZ7eHu9vgP3YQk1r7XWi7l4qSkgtGSSG7FD2kTPAxBmjUNrh3HfaKYPUrUf1JVL8S1VFiB90cIAcA_0BZYMxpxX4AZp1tgQ</recordid><startdate>20180301</startdate><enddate>20180301</enddate><creator>Mallikarachchi, Thanuja</creator><creator>Talagala, Dumidu S.</creator><creator>Arachchi, Hemantha Kodikara</creator><creator>Fernando, Anil</creator><general>IEEE</general><general>The Institute of Electrical and Electronics Engineers, Inc. (IEEE)</general><scope>97E</scope><scope>RIA</scope><scope>RIE</scope><scope>AAYXX</scope><scope>CITATION</scope><scope>7SC</scope><scope>7SP</scope><scope>8FD</scope><scope>JQ2</scope><scope>L7M</scope><scope>L~C</scope><scope>L~D</scope><orcidid>https://orcid.org/0000-0001-9817-927X</orcidid></search><sort><creationdate>20180301</creationdate><title>Content-Adaptive Feature-Based CU Size Prediction for Fast Low-Delay Video Encoding in HEVC</title><author>Mallikarachchi, Thanuja ; Talagala, Dumidu S. ; Arachchi, Hemantha Kodikara ; Fernando, Anil</author></sort><facets><frbrtype>5</frbrtype><frbrgroupid>cdi_FETCH-LOGICAL-c339t-d0cf99cb64a00b640efb788ede214743b94dfaa5eab62c389d8cd8c3dac73c653</frbrgroupid><rsrctype>articles</rsrctype><prefilter>articles</prefilter><language>eng</language><creationdate>2018</creationdate><topic>Adaptation models</topic><topic>Algorithms</topic><topic>Coding</topic><topic>Coding unit (CU) size</topic><topic>Computational complexity</topic><topic>Computer architecture</topic><topic>Delay</topic><topic>Encoding</topic><topic>High definition</topic><topic>High Efficiency Video Coding (HEVC)</topic><topic>low delay</topic><topic>motion classification</topic><topic>Motion simulation</topic><topic>Optimization</topic><topic>Prediction algorithms</topic><topic>ratedistortion (RD) optimization</topic><topic>video coding</topic><topic>Video compression</topic><toplevel>peer_reviewed</toplevel><toplevel>online_resources</toplevel><creatorcontrib>Mallikarachchi, Thanuja</creatorcontrib><creatorcontrib>Talagala, Dumidu S.</creatorcontrib><creatorcontrib>Arachchi, Hemantha Kodikara</creatorcontrib><creatorcontrib>Fernando, Anil</creatorcontrib><collection>IEEE All-Society Periodicals Package (ASPP) 2005-present</collection><collection>IEEE All-Society Periodicals Package (ASPP) 1998-Present</collection><collection>IEEE Xplore</collection><collection>CrossRef</collection><collection>Computer and Information Systems Abstracts</collection><collection>Electronics &amp; Communications Abstracts</collection><collection>Technology Research Database</collection><collection>ProQuest Computer Science Collection</collection><collection>Advanced Technologies Database with Aerospace</collection><collection>Computer and Information Systems Abstracts – Academic</collection><collection>Computer and Information Systems Abstracts Professional</collection><jtitle>IEEE transactions on circuits and systems for video technology</jtitle></facets><delivery><delcategory>Remote Search Resource</delcategory><fulltext>fulltext</fulltext></delivery><addata><au>Mallikarachchi, Thanuja</au><au>Talagala, Dumidu S.</au><au>Arachchi, Hemantha Kodikara</au><au>Fernando, Anil</au><format>journal</format><genre>article</genre><ristype>JOUR</ristype><atitle>Content-Adaptive Feature-Based CU Size Prediction for Fast Low-Delay Video Encoding in HEVC</atitle><jtitle>IEEE transactions on circuits and systems for video technology</jtitle><stitle>TCSVT</stitle><date>2018-03-01</date><risdate>2018</risdate><volume>28</volume><issue>3</issue><spage>693</spage><epage>705</epage><pages>693-705</pages><issn>1051-8215</issn><eissn>1558-2205</eissn><coden>ITCTEM</coden><abstract>Determining the best partitioning structure of a coding tree unit is one of the most time-consuming operations in High Efficiency Video Coding (HEVC) encoding. Specifically, it is the evaluation of the quadtree hierarchy using the rate-distortion (RD) optimization that has the most significant impact on the encoding time, especially in the cases of high definition (HD) and ultra HD videos. In order to expedite the encoding for low-delay applications, this paper proposes a coding unit (CU) size selection and encoding algorithm for inter prediction in the HEVC. To this end, it describes: 1) two CU classification models based on Inter &lt;inline-formula&gt; &lt;tex-math notation="LaTeX"&gt;N\times N &lt;/tex-math&gt;&lt;/inline-formula&gt; mode motion features and RD cost thresholds to predict the CU split decision; 2) an online training scheme for dynamic content adaptation; 3) a motion vector reuse mechanism to expedite the motion estimation process; and 4) finally introduces a computational complexity to coding efficiency tradeoff process to enable flexible control of the algorithm. The experimental results reveal that the proposed algorithm achieves a consistent average encoding time performance ranging from 55%-58% and 57%-61% with average Bjøntegaard delta bit rate increases of 1.93%-2.26% and 2.14%-2.33% compared with the HEVC 16.0 reference software for the low delay P and low delay B configurations, respectively, across a wide range of content types and bit rates.</abstract><cop>New York</cop><pub>IEEE</pub><doi>10.1109/TCSVT.2016.2619499</doi><tpages>13</tpages><orcidid>https://orcid.org/0000-0001-9817-927X</orcidid><oa>free_for_read</oa></addata></record>
fulltext fulltext
identifier ISSN: 1051-8215
ispartof IEEE transactions on circuits and systems for video technology, 2018-03, Vol.28 (3), p.693-705
issn 1051-8215
1558-2205
language eng
recordid cdi_proquest_journals_2174532169
source IEEE Xplore (Online service)
subjects Adaptation models
Algorithms
Coding
Coding unit (CU) size
Computational complexity
Computer architecture
Delay
Encoding
High definition
High Efficiency Video Coding (HEVC)
low delay
motion classification
Motion simulation
Optimization
Prediction algorithms
ratedistortion (RD) optimization
video coding
Video compression
title Content-Adaptive Feature-Based CU Size Prediction for Fast Low-Delay Video Encoding in HEVC
url http://sfxeu10.hosted.exlibrisgroup.com/loughborough?ctx_ver=Z39.88-2004&ctx_enc=info:ofi/enc:UTF-8&ctx_tim=2024-12-26T13%3A44%3A31IST&url_ver=Z39.88-2004&url_ctx_fmt=infofi/fmt:kev:mtx:ctx&rfr_id=info:sid/primo.exlibrisgroup.com:primo3-Article-proquest_cross&rft_val_fmt=info:ofi/fmt:kev:mtx:journal&rft.genre=article&rft.atitle=Content-Adaptive%20Feature-Based%20CU%20Size%20Prediction%20for%20Fast%20Low-Delay%20Video%20Encoding%20in%20HEVC&rft.jtitle=IEEE%20transactions%20on%20circuits%20and%20systems%20for%20video%20technology&rft.au=Mallikarachchi,%20Thanuja&rft.date=2018-03-01&rft.volume=28&rft.issue=3&rft.spage=693&rft.epage=705&rft.pages=693-705&rft.issn=1051-8215&rft.eissn=1558-2205&rft.coden=ITCTEM&rft_id=info:doi/10.1109/TCSVT.2016.2619499&rft_dat=%3Cproquest_cross%3E2174532169%3C/proquest_cross%3E%3Cgrp_id%3Ecdi_FETCH-LOGICAL-c339t-d0cf99cb64a00b640efb788ede214743b94dfaa5eab62c389d8cd8c3dac73c653%3C/grp_id%3E%3Coa%3E%3C/oa%3E%3Curl%3E%3C/url%3E&rft_id=info:oai/&rft_pqid=2174532169&rft_id=info:pmid/&rft_ieee_id=7600428&rfr_iscdi=true